Combine the mango cubes, cold water, lime juice, sugar, and salt in a blender. Blend on high until completely smooth, about 45โ60 seconds.
Set a fine-mesh strainer over a pitcher and pour the blended mixture through it, pressing gently with a spoon to extract as much liquid as possible. Discard the solids left in the strainer.
